What are sewing jobs with no experience required?

Sewing jobs with no experience required are entry-level positions where you can start working without prior professional sewing skills. These roles often include tasks like basic stitching, hemming, or operating simple sewing machines under supervision. Employers typically provide on-the-job training, making these jobs accessible to beginners who are willing to learn. Such positions can be found in garment factories, alteration shops, or textile manufacturing companies. They offer a great way to gain practical sewing experience and develop your skills for more advanced roles in the future.

What types of training or onboarding can I expect when starting a sewing job with no prior experience?

Most employers hiring for entry-level sewing positions provide hands-on training and shadowing opportunities during your first few weeks. You’ll typically learn how to use industrial sewing machines, read simple patterns, and follow safety procedures under the supervision of experienced staff. Many workplaces pair new hires with mentors and offer ongoing support as you build your skills. This supportive environment helps you gain confidence and quickly become a productive team member, even if you’re new to sewing.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in an entry-level sewing role with no prior experience, and why are they important?

To thrive in an entry-level sewing position with no experience, you need basic manual dexterity, attention to detail, and a willingness to learn. Familiarity with sewing machines, simple stitching techniques, and safety procedures is typically taught on the job, though some employers may value completion of introductory sewing courses or workshops. Patience, reliability, and the ability to follow instructions carefully will help you stand out. These skills ensure quality workmanship, safe operation, and efficient contribution to production or repair tasks.

Job description

General Responsibility:
  • Responsible for sewing fabric/leather/vinyl chair covers.
  • Following the direction of lead sewer

Specific Duties or Tasks:
  • Sew fabric, leather and vinyl covers for chairs, sofas, and loveseats.
  • Ability to match pieces of cut material together and sew with appropriate stitch to produce quality cover.
  • Ability to follow written instructions.
  • Ability to Sew 25% of product styles at plus 90% efficiency.

Skills Requirement:
  • Ability to operate single stitch, double stitch, serge, and tunnel tie sewing machines.
  • Ability to thread sewing machine and make simple adjustments.
  • Minimum three (3) years experience in upholstery sewing.

Specific Responsibilities Related to Environment, Health and Safety (EHS):
  • Consistently follows EHS general rules and procedures and is aware of the EHS policy.
  • Demonstrates good initiative for working safely, reporting, and participating in EHS.

Physical Demands:
  • Light lifting and carrying up to 20 lbs, straight pulling, use of fingers, depth perception, ability to distinguish color and shades.
